Attractions and Hotels Near Moniquira

Don't skedaddle without taking a look at what you can discover in the wider region of Boyaca. View Boyaca's rural landscapes, beaches, forests and rivers. You could also visit some of the region's old towns. In this part of Colombia, energetic types can also go rock climbing.

If you want to explore some nearby cities, consider Villa de Leyva and Tunja. Travel 30 kilometres to the south from Moniquira and you'll locate Villa de Leyva. That said, Tunja is 45 kilometres to the southeast. Villa de Leyva hotels are the Hotel Casa de Adobe and Hotel & Spa Getsemaní.
